The phrase refers to digital image files of the Wonder Woman emblem designed for easy at-home printing. These files are typically available in various formats, such as JPG, PNG, or PDF, allowing users to reproduce the iconic symbol on paper, fabric transfers, or other printable media. For example, an individual might download a file to create a Wonder Woman-themed birthday banner or decorate a t-shirt.
The availability of such print-ready assets provides a convenient and cost-effective way to incorporate the recognized symbol into personal projects, themed events, or fan merchandise. The popularity of the character ensures a consistent demand for resources that allow fans to express their affinity through DIY crafts and decorative items. Historically, access to brand imagery was restricted, but digital distribution has democratized access, enabling wider adoption in non-commercial settings.
